The Society of St. Vincent de Paul Blessed Sacrament Conference provides direct financial and material assistance to people experiencing poverty in Toronto. Volunteers visit individuals and families in their homes to understand their circumstances and offer practical support, including emergency rent and utility payments, food assistance, clothing, and household necessities. The organization operates through a network of trained volunteers who form small groups called conferences, working within their local communities to address immediate needs while treating those they help with dignity and respect. By focusing on personal relationships rather than bureaucratic processes, the conference aims to break cycles of poverty through both material aid and human connection.
